Message from Catriona Gill and NHS Lothian

As you may already know, we are aware of a person in the nursery who has tested positive for COVID-19. We have been working closely with NHS Lothian Health Protection Team and following all national guidance. Persons have now been contacted because they have been in close and sustained contact with the case and the tracking process is now complete.

These contacts will need to self-isolate and have been asked to book a COVID-19 test. Appropriate guidance and advice have been given.

If you have not been contacted and your child remains well, you should continue to follow the school’s / setting’s existing arrangements for your child.

Enhanced cleaning and infection control measures are in place in line with national guidance. The nursery is safe and remains open.

If you have any concerns in the meantime, or if you need to book a COVID-19 test because your child has developed symptoms (high temperature, a new continuous cough and/or a loss or change in sense of smell or taste) please visit the NHS Inform website http://www.nhsinform.scot or for non-clinical advice call 0800 028 2816.

Please note that a test should only ever be booked if you or your child has these specifics symptoms.

Remember to stay at home if anyone in the household has symptoms of COVID-19.

For further information you may find this Frequently Asked Questions document useful : https://www.nhslothian.scot/Coronavirus/Parents/Schools/Pages/default.aspx
